I am not a DAR and thus my original question. With that said my research into this stated that once a registration has expired (regardless of reason) for more than 90 days the n-number is on hold and unavailable for 5 yrs. I could find no mention of registering the number again during this time regardless of who was trying to do it. That brought me to the AW cert and whether or not a whole new AW inspection was needed.
